Job Description Biogen is presently looking to fill a Director position within its Anti-Sense Oligonucleotide (ASO) Development and Manufacturing Group. The candidate will lead a team responsible for the development of parenteral oligonucleotide formulations and drug product manufacturing (DP) processes supporting Biogen’s growing pipeline. The Candidate must be motivated and innovative with exceptional analytical and communication skills.
This is a hybrid role based out of our headquarters in Cambridge, MA.
What You’ll Do
1) Lead a team of scientists/engineers to develop DS formulations and DP processes to support Biogen’s clinical and commercial oligonucleotide programs
2) Lead cross-functional teams to transfer parenteral DP manufacturing processes internally and externally with Biogen’s CMOs, including providing on-site technical support, troubleshooting, and intercompany communication
3) Direct technical innovation projects with internal/external collaborators to drive innovative nanoparticle formulations, blood-brain barrier initiatives (device and formulations) drug delivery or DP solutions- acts as the local expert for due diligence and technology assessment projects
4) Provide leadership support/guidance to CMC teams and subject matter expertise for global regulatory filings- devise filing content strategy for global dossiers and partner with manufacturing teams to communicate control strategies and validation practices
